The matchup between Mills and Hillsdale on Tuesday hardly resembled the 2-1 effort from their previous meeting. The Vikings lost 15-7 to the Knights. Unfortunately, that's the third time they've come up short against the Knights this season, with their most recent defeat being a 2-1 loss back in April.
Lucy Esquivel made the most of her time in the batter's box despite the final result and went 1-for-4 with one home run and two RBI. Alyssa Penas was another key player, going 2-for-4 with one home run and two runs.
Mills' loss dropped their record down to 13-10. As for Hillsdale, they have been performing well recently as they've won nine of their last 11 contests. That's provided a nice bump to their 17-9 record this season.
Mills will challenge Woodside at 4:30 p.m. on Thursday. The Wildcats' pitching crew has only allowed four runs per game this season, so the Vikings' hitters will have their work cut out for them. Hillsdale does not have any more games scheduled as of now.
